"Did Jesus Christ truly rise from the dead?


In this sermon on Matthew 28:1–15, we consider one of the most important questions in all of history: is the resurrection a real historical event? The Christian faith does not rest on vague spiritual principles or moral lessons, but on the concrete historical act of God in raising Jesus from the dead.


We walk carefully through the resurrection accounts in all four Gospels, showing how the details are complementary, coherent, and harmonizable, rather than contradictory. From the women at the tomb, to Peter and John’s visit, to Christ’s appearances to Mary Magdalene, the Emmaus disciples, and the apostles, the testimony of Scripture presents a unified witness to the risen Christ.


We also examine the major objections raised against the resurrection:


Did the disciples steal the body?

Did Jesus merely survive crucifixion?

Were the appearances hallucinations?

Why was the body never produced?


The empty tomb, the explosive spread of Christianity, and the apostolic witness all point to one unavoidable conclusion: Jesus Christ was truly raised from the dead.


Because if Christ is risen, then sin, death, and Satan have been defeated—and that changes everything.
